Sibanye appoints global energy leader as nonexec director

JSE- and NYSE-listed precious metals miner Sibanye-Stillwater has appointed Philippe Boisseau an independent nonexecutive director, effective April 8.

He brings to the board more than 25 years of executive leadership experience, including three years as CEO of Spanish energy business Compañía Española de Petróleos.

Boisseau also has two decades of working experience at TotalEnergies, having headed up the refining and upstream businesses, as well as Total’s business in the Middle East.

He will also serve as a member of Sibanye’s audit and risk, nominations, and safety, environment and sustainability committees.

Boisseau previously had an advisory role with Sibanye to refine the company’s strategic approach to prioritising more metals and energy investments.
